Title: LMCE-1204-20151215185231754 notes
Post by: pigdog on December 19, 2015, 03:48:50 PM
Hi,

Tried 3X and each time was stalled on tty1 screen with the following...

Ubuntu 12.04.5 LTS dcerouter tty1

dcerouter ligin:ConfrimDependencies is running
ConfirmDependencies is done
InstallNewDevice is running
Starting local devices

On 3rd attempt waited 45 minutes hit the Enter key and got login prompt.

Logged in as user, went root, then update/upgrade.

Rebooted and LMCE came up.

NAS and Media recognized.  Tried a diskless MD and no go.  Configuration file not found.

Will try TBZ unless other suggestions provided.

Overall, the snap runs but only with manual intervention.

There is a bug in this dvd that sets autostartmedia=0 in pluto.conf, you can manually set that to a 1 and reboot after installation.
